While alpha-linolenic acid (ALA) exists in plant sources like flaxseeds, the conversion rate to EPA and DHA in the human body is notoriously inefficient. Research indicates that a diet rich in omega-3s may help prevent age-related macular degeneration, a leading cause of vision loss in older adults.
